Output 65403dbea91ecce442f67d13b69793553ff9501ad54539cddbf51cfcf73a9e98:0

value
23687802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54731048761e3e6b3b589649f5c261c007baf40b OP_EQUAL
address
39PYXR91AyJkaWGxGX4MKmgaS6tsaGVU7c
transaction
65403dbea91ecce442f67d13b69793553ff9501ad54539cddbf51cfcf73a9e98
confirmations
298894
spent
true